Transaction 78c9068dcc291594d00d8dc7ff284ae32cd4d7a6cbdfcf9d406d9d51da527414

6 Input
2 Outputs
  • 78c9068dcc291594d00d8dc7ff284ae32cd4d7a6cbdfcf9d406d9d51da527414:0
  • value  14139
    address  1FEPH7EiDrX4nrq5ajzHJpA3AtNptCzGkH
  • 78c9068dcc291594d00d8dc7ff284ae32cd4d7a6cbdfcf9d406d9d51da527414:1
  • value  1340100
    address  1K2EK1hSC3uUPU9BjFngQmpBwUGZDxXEdV